Jiří Málek is a scholar working on Signal Processing, Artificial Intelligence and Computational Mechanics. According to data from OpenAlex, Jiří Málek has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 258 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Signal Processing, 13 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 8 papers in Computational Mechanics. Recurrent topics in Jiří Málek's work include Speech and Audio Processing (20 papers), Blind Source Separation Techniques (13 papers) and Speech Recognition and Synthesis (12 papers). Jiří Málek is often cited by papers focused on Speech and Audio Processing (20 papers), Blind Source Separation Techniques (13 papers) and Speech Recognition and Synthesis (12 papers). Jiří Málek collaborates with scholars based in Czechia, Germany and Israel. Jiří Málek's co-authors include Zbyněk Koldovský, Petr Tichavský, Sharon Gannot, Jindřich Žďánský, Karl Krissian, Mariem Ben Abdallah, Rached Tourki, Petr Červa, Francesco Nesta and Jan Nouza and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ical review. B, Condensed matter, IEEE Transactions on Signal Processing and Signal Processing.
